In 1921, Walter Johnson struck out his 2,804th batter, which moved him past Cy Young as the all-time leader in strikeouts. His record lasted until 1982, when Nolan Ryan surpassed him.
**factoid courtesy of ‘Armchair Reader – Grand Slam Baseball’

Buddy Bell was a pretty popular guy in Cincinnati. One of the main reasons? He was Gus Bell’s kid. Gus played nine seasons in Cincinnati, and all four of his All-Star selections came while wearing the Reds uniform.
